Sports Mole takes an in-depth look at how Chelsea could line up for Saturday's Premier League clash with Fulham.

Since this article was published, this match has been postponed due to the death of Queen Elizabeth II.

Chelsea begin life without Thomas Tuchel in the dugout on Saturday lunchtime, with Fulham lying in wait at Craven Cottage for the latest edition of the West London derby.

The German lost his job after his 100th game in charge ended in defeat to Dinamo Zagreb in the Champions League, and confirmation of Graham Potter's appointment is expected before the weekend.

The Brighton & Hove Albion boss will likely take a backseat for this one as the Blues' interim staff take charge, and it therefore remains to be seen which system will be adopted by those in blue.

Only N'Golo Kante (thigh) should be missing for the visitors, who will likely recall Edouard Mendy and Thiago Silva to the backline in place of Kepa Arrizabalaga and Cesar Azpilicueta.

Wesley Fofana and Kalidou Koulibaly will expect to hold their places if the three-man defence lives another day, while Marc Cucurella ought to be in with a shout of demoting Ben Chilwell to the bench.

With an abundance of midfield options to choose from, Jorginho and Mateo Kovacic will hope to pair up as Denis Zakaria and Carney Chukwuemeka are forced to wait patiently for their opportunities.

Mason Mount has not covered himself in glory so far this season, but the England international may be preferred to Kai Havertz alongside Raheem Sterling and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ang.

The latter's debut in midweek lasted all of 59 minutes, but the ex-Arsenal man should hold his place in the XI over Armando Broja, who recently signed a new six-year deal at the club.

Chelsea possible starting lineup: Mendy; Fofana, Silva, Koulibaly; James, Jorginho, Kovacic, Cucurella; Mount, Aubameyang, Sterling
